SNAP程序是由NRC资助开发的用于简化分析过程的软件,本文对SNAP程序进行了详细的介绍,并利用SNAP程序与RELAP5/MOD3.3程序对某典型四环路压水堆进行模拟,描述了SNAP程序在核电厂安全分析中应用的特点,并对关键现象进行分析。研究表明,SNAP程序的应用可以大大简化程序建模和数据处理过程,并能直观实时的观测计算结果,在核电厂安全分析中应用的前景广泛。  相似文献

This paper introduces a research agenda to explore the intersection of e-government implementation and the key federal programs – Medicaid, the Supplemental Nutrition Assistance Program (SNAP, a.k.a. food stamps), (SSI), and Temporary Assistance to Needy Families (TANF, a.k.a. welfare) – that provide assistance to low-income citizens in the United States. To lay the groundwork for on-going research, this paper focuses on the implementing statutes that require different levels of automation for delivering these programs to the public. It discusses the programs in terms of their breadth, impacts to recipients, and the effects of automation as implemented for each. It identifies some of the consequences of automation, such as potentially faster service delivery, different approaches to information access, and issues of privacy. It then suggests some points to consider for policymakers and for future research to more deeply understand this unique and little-studied aspect of e-government implementation. By understanding the impacts of implementing statutes on the poor, policymakers can develop a deliberately inclusive strategy that leverages technology to support access to assistance in measurable models that can be implemented at the federal, state, and county levels. This can further democratize the government-to-citizen relationship and support greater accountability to taxpayers.  相似文献
